    In: tm - Technisches Messen, Walter de Gruyter GmbH, Vol. 86, No. s1 ( 2019-09-01), p. 77-81
    Abstract: Dieses Paper zeigt einen möglichen Aufbau zur in situ Messung der Positionierabweichung von seriell angeordneten Rotationseinheiten mit einem konstanten, gemeinsamen Momentanpol. Mit Hilfe dieses Aufbaus kann die Position des letzten Gliedes der kinematischen Kette in allen drei Raumachsen gemessen werden. Dazu wird der Abstand zu einer hemisphärischen Referenzfläche mit drei mitbewegten kartesisch angeordneten Fabry-Pérot-Interferometern gemessen. Diese Interferometer werden hinlänglich ihrer Eignung zur Messung auf einer gekrümmten Referenzfläche untersucht. Sie zeigen eine periodische Nichtlinearität von ±10nm und eine Positionswiederholbarkeit mit einer Standardabweichung von unter 1.6nm.

    In: Pharmaceutics, MDPI AG, Vol. 14, No. 11 ( 2022-10-29), p. 2335-
    Abstract: To date, there is no approved local therapeutic agent for the treatment of epistaxis due to hereditary hemorrhagic telangiectasia (HHT). Several case reports suggest the topical use of timolol. This monocentric, prospective, randomized, placebo-controlled, double-blinded, cross-over study investigated whether the effectiveness of the standard treatment with a pulsed diode laser can be increased by also using timolol nasal spray. The primary outcome was severity of epistaxis after three months, while the main secondary outcome was severity of epistaxis and subjective satisfaction after one month. Twenty patients were allocated and treated, of which 18 patients completed both 3-month treatment sequences. Timolol was well tolerated by all patients. Epistaxis Severity Score after three months, the primary outcome measure, showed a beneficial, but statistically nonsignificant (p = 0.084), effect of additional timolol application. Epistaxis Severity Score (p = 0.010) and patients’ satisfaction with their nosebleeds after one month (p = 0.050) showed statistically significant benefits. This placebo-controlled, randomized trial provides some evidence that timolol nasal spray positively impacts epistaxis severity and subjective satisfaction in HHT patients when additively applied to standard laser therapy after one month. However, the effect of timolol was observed to diminish over time. Trials with larger sample sizes are warranted to confirm these findings.

    In: tm - Technisches Messen, Walter de Gruyter GmbH, Vol. 85, No. 4 ( 2018-4-25), p. 244-251
    Abstract: Tiltmeters with nanorad resolution in a large measurement range of ±9 mrad (±0.5 ○ ) and a very good linearity have been developed at the Technische Universität Ilmenau in the recent years. The working principle bases on the measurement of tilt-dependent lateral forces, which act on a hanging force-compensated weigh cell (precision balance). The disadvantage is the relatively complex design of the weigh cell mechanics, the large dead weight and the high manufacturing costs. For that reason a simplified tiltmeter was developed. It only consists of two components: a monolithic pendulum mechanics and an optical position sensor. State of the art pendulum tiltmeters contain several components that are linked by screwed, clamped or glued connections. This can limit the long-term-, temperature- or humidity stability of the tiltmeter. The position sensor achieves a standard deviation of ∼ 50 pm at a measuring frequency of 10 Hz. The length of the pendulum amounts to 0.1 m, its mass is ∼ 62 g. With this combination, the theoretical standard deviation of the tilt measurement should result to ∼ 0.6 nrad at 10 Hz measuring frequency and was approved by measurements. The measurement range of the new monolithic tiltmeter amounts ∼ ±2 mrad.
